January Weather in Ape, Latvia

Last updated: August 23, 2025

In January, the average temperature in Ape, Latvia hovers around -3°C (27°F). However, be prepared for an extreme range, as temperatures can plunge to a chilling -23°C (-10°F) or, at best, reach up to 7°C (45°F). With 40 mm (1.6 in) of precipitation spread over 10 days, you can expect a damp atmosphere, complemented by an average humidity of 94%.

How January Weather in Ape Compares to Other Months

Weather in Ape varies notably across the year, with each month offering distinct climate conditions. This page compares January’s weather to other months in Ape, focusing on differences in temperature, rainfall, humidity, and UV levels.

This table compares monthly weather conditions in Ape, showing how January’s temperature, precipitation, humidity, and UV index levels differ from those of other months.
 TemperaturePrecipitationHumidityUV
January Weather-3°C (27°F)40 mm (1.6 inches)94%low
February Weather-3°C (27°F)42 mm (1.7 inches)92%low
March Weather0°C (33°F)50 mm (2.0 inches)89%moderate
April Weather5°C (42°F)51 mm (2.0 inches)87%moderate
May Weather11°C (52°F)67 mm (2.6 inches)70%high
June Weather17°C (62°F)78 mm (3.1 inches)77%high
July Weather18°C (64°F)76 mm (3.0 inches)78%high
August Weather16°C (62°F)103 mm (4.0 inches)81%high
September Weather12°C (54°F)75 mm (2.9 inches)88%moderate
October Weather7°C (45°F)78 mm (3.1 inches)92%low
November Weather3°C (37°F)59 mm (2.3 inches)93%low
December Weather-2°C (29°F)58 mm (2.3 inches)93%low
